Casa Bombo Bed & Breakfast - Granada
37.180092, -3.593537Overview
Nestled in Albaicin, which is the city's old Muslim quarter, 16 minutes' walk from Carmen de los Martires, the charming Casa Bombo Bed & Breakfast Granada features an outdoor swimming pool and views of the courtyard. Guests can take advantage of private car parking for EUR 20 per day on site.
Location
The 3-star hotel is near a train station and in the neighbourhood of Mirador de San Nicolas. The Casa Bombo Bed & Breakfast Granada is also located just 5 minutes' stroll from Church of San Gil y Santa Ana and a 13-minute walk from Plaza Nueva. The area offers shopping experiences such as Plaza Bib-Rambla, which is not very far from this charming property.
For those travelling from afar, Federico Garcia Lorca Granada-Jaen airport is 35 minutes' drive away.
Rooms
The 7 rooms at the hotel include an individual terrace and a balcony. Some of the rooms feature spacious decor furnished with a sofa set and a work desk. Guests can use a bidet and a tub, along with bathrobes and slippers. A separate toilet and a shower are available in private bathrooms.
Eat & Drink
The lounge bar will set you up nicely for enjoying your stay. Restaurante Ruta del Azafran serves Mediterranean dishes and lies 6 minutes' walk from this Granada hotel.
Leisure & Business
Guests also have access to a swimming pool and a sun deck at an extra charge. Beach facilities at the Casa Bombo Bed & Breakfast include loungers and parasols. The Casa Bombo Bed & Breakfast Granada features a variety of activities such as hiking and cycling.
